Roughmath - Buzzkill Remixes

I have been a huge fan of Roughmath ever since his days as Noir, but today I bring you an awesome conglomerate of remixes of Roughmath’s last EP, “Buzzkill”. Kicking off this remix EP is Archie Cane. I wish he would release more tunes because his style is rarely seen. The into has a bit of a Garage feel to it, but the drop is filthy per usual. My first listen to Jarvis’ remix left me on the fence, it may have been where I decided I would start listening to it. After my second listen with better placement, the track finally came together in my ears. Jarvis’ defined epic for me.

Koven on the other hand catches your attention no matter where you click play. He is still one of the dirtiest up and coming bass producers out there. His drops are full of some the heaviest progressions you will find and Maksim taking point on the vocal turned out to be a match made in Heaven. Last but certainly not least is a remix from our friend Skit. Lately Skit has been pushing out some beautiful Hip-Hop and R&B infused bass tracks that have been revolutionizing how I view each genre. His remix of “Cold” however takes us back through his skills as a Dubstep producer, to say the least it is quite impressive. Roughmath assembled one of the best Remix EPs I have heard in Dubstep in a while. Maybe this will set an example for others to come.
